The Role
At Digital Turbine, we make mobile advertising and discovery experiences more meaningful for users, app publishers, and advertisers — intelligently connecting people across more devices than anyone else in our space. Our on-device footprint, Ignite, ships with hundreds of millions of devices through the world’s leading OEMs and carriers, and is the foundation of our strategy to maximize the value of our on-device presence.
As a Senior Mobile Engineer, you’ll build and harden the SDKs and on-device services that power app delivery, discovery, and monetization at carrier and OEM scale. This is a high-impact role on a small, autonomous team that owns its products end to end — from design through release, monitoring, and on-call. Your work directly supports our FY27 goals of reducing installation failures, enabling dynamic app delivery, and extending our on-device presence into alternative distribution.
Aboutthe Senior Mobile Engineer Role
Design, build, and maintain high-performance Android SDKs and on-device services (with iOS work as our cross-platform footprint grows), focusing on reliability, footprint, battery, and security
Drive down install and delivery failures — improving package-manager reliability, dynamic app-delivery (ASR), and recovery paths across a highly fragmented device and OS landscape
Partner with OEM and carrier integration teams to ship features that operate within tight platform, privacy, and resource constraints
Extend on-device surfaces that power alternative distribution and brand-on-device experiences, a key pillar of DT’s FY27 roadmap
Own the full lifecycle of what you build: instrumentation, alerting, rollout strategy, A/B experimentation, and on-call for your services
Raise the bar on code quality through reviews, automated testing, and tooling, and mentor other engineers on mobile best practices
